The Udaipur City Palace is the largest palace complex in
Rajasthan. Construction began in 1600 and it was occupied by the maharajas
(kings) until the 1950s.
90 Km from Udaipur is Ranakpur where one of the 5 holiest Jain temples is
located. This temple was built in 1439. Fundamental to Jain beliefs is ahimsa,
non-violence, in thought and deed.
Within
Ranakpur's Jain temple, there are 29 halls supported by 1444 marble
pillars. Each pillar is ornately carved and no two are alike.
The
Lake Palace Hotel is located on an island in the middle of Udaipur's Lake
Pichola. This used to be the summer home of the maharaja. Today it is a five
star luxury hotel.
